Re: Como instalar duas imagens do Kernel

2004-04-08 Por tôpico Dani

oi Savio!:-)
quando vc muda a revisao na verdade vc nao muda de fato o 
kernel(versao...) ou seja ele continua sendo 2.4.25 por exemplo:-).  o 
diretorio /lib/modules/versao do kernel contem os modulos do kernel em 
questao:-) e sim ele e' muito importante pois contem os modulos 
compilados daquele kernel:-). se vc quiser que seja gerados diretorios 
diferentes sob /lib/modules para cada nova versao de kernel, vc deve 
gerar versoes 'fake' (vc deve alterar o parametro extraversion do 
Makefile que esta' na raiz do kernel, pois dai' ele vai incluir esta 
versao 'fake' como parte do nome do novo kernel e portanto um diretorio 
novo sob /lib/modules.

espero ter ajudado:-)

[]'s Dani:-)

Savio Ramos wrote:

Olá,

1. Compilei uma imagem do núcleo com o make kernel_image;
2. Instalei o pacote gerado;
3. Compilei novamente o núcleo com uma versão 1;
4. Quando instalei o novo pacote gerado o dpkg sumiu com a imagem 
anterior. Só restando a imagem 2.4.18bf4 original e a versão 1.

_Perguntas_

A) Durante a instalação da imagem versão 1, o dpkg avisou que iria 
sobrescrever o diretório /lib/modules. Este diretório é necessário a imagem do 
núcleo? Para que?

B) Não é possível se instalar uma nova versão do núcleo compilado sem 
desinstalar a anterior? Eu desejo ter várias versões para comparar.


Grato.





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Savio Ramos
Olá,

1. Compilei uma imagem do núcleo com o make kernel_image;
2. Instalei o pacote gerado;
3. Compilei novamente o núcleo com uma versão 1;
4. Quando instalei o novo pacote gerado o dpkg sumiu com a imagem 
anterior. Só restando a imagem 2.4.18bf4 original e a versão 1.

_Perguntas_

A) Durante a instalação da imagem versão 1, o dpkg avisou que iria 
sobrescrever o diretório /lib/modules. Este diretório é necessário a imagem do 
núcleo? Para que?

B) Não é possível se instalar uma nova versão do núcleo compilado sem 
desinstalar a anterior? Eu desejo ter várias versões para comparar.


Grato.
-- 
Savio Martins Ramos Arquiteto
Rio de Janeiro  ICQ 174972645
Pirataria não!  Use GNU/Linux
Debian-br #705 Unstable
http://www.debian.org



Re: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Jupercio Juliano

Savio Ramos wrote:



A) Durante a instalação da imagem versão 1, o dpkg avisou que iria 
sobrescrever o diretório /lib/modules. Este diretório é necessário a imagem do 
núcleo? Para que?


São os módulos do seu kernel que estão nesta pasta.



B) Não é possível se instalar uma nova versão do núcleo compilado sem 
desinstalar a anterior? Eu desejo ter várias versões para comparar.


	Bom pra não sobrescrever a imagem anterior, sempre renomeava ela e 
todos os arquivos que fazem referência, que estão no /boot, e também o 
diretório do /lib/modules.

Também acho falho o dpkg não avisar que esta imagem será sobrescrita.

Abraços.
--
jupercio juliano
GNU/Linux User #262957 www.counter.li.org
DebianUser www.debian-br.org



Re: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Douglas Adriano Augusto
No dia 06/04/2004 às 13:43,
Savio Ramos [EMAIL PROTECTED] escreveu:

   A) Durante a instalação da imagem versão 1, o dpkg avisou que iria 
 sobrescrever o diretório /lib/modules. Este diretório é necessário a imagem 
 do núcleo? Para que?

São os módulos do quérnel. Se você gerou  um pacote cuja versão do quérnel é
a mesma de uma já instalada, corre o risco de sobrescrever.

   B) Não é possível se instalar uma nova versão do núcleo compilado sem 
 desinstalar a anterior? Eu desejo ter várias versões para comparar.

Se você  a cada imagem atribuir-lhe  uma versão diferente, dá  para conviver
sem problemas. É  só ajustar os gerenciador de boot  (lilo) para enxergar os
componentes da nova imagem (vmlinuz e initrd) que ficam em '/boot'.


-- 
Douglas Augusto
  [Netiqueta]
§ Evitar e-mails HTML, mesmo oferecendo alternativa puramente textual.



Re: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Alexandre Martani
Em Tue, 6 Apr 2004 13:43:45 -0300
Savio Ramos [EMAIL PROTECTED] escreveu:

 Olá,
 
   1. Compilei uma imagem do núcleo com o make kernel_image;
   2. Instalei o pacote gerado;
   3. Compilei novamente o núcleo com uma versão 1;
   4. Quando instalei o novo pacote gerado o dpkg sumiu com a
   imagem anterior. Só restando a imagem 2.4.18bf4 original e a
   versão 1.
 
   _Perguntas_
 
   A) Durante a instalação da imagem versão 1, o dpkg avisou que
   iria sobrescrever o diretório /lib/modules. Este diretório é
   necessário a imagem do núcleo? Para que?
 
   B) Não é possível se instalar uma nova versão do núcleo
   compilado sem desinstalar a anterior? Eu desejo ter várias
   versões para comparar.
 

Olá Savio,

Acho que se você der o make-kpkg com o argumento --append_to_version
algumacoisa você consegue, desde que use cada vez um algumacoisa
diferente, pois assim o sistema passará a reconhecer a versão como, por
exemplo, 2.4.24algumacoisa.

-- 
Alexandre Martani
amartani em uol com br

Ainda usando Rwindow$ + Internet Exploder + Outloco Expresso?
Mude!

GNU/Linux + Mozilla Firefox + Sylpheed



Re: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Savio Ramos
On Tue, 6 Apr 2004 15:30:46 -0300
Douglas Adriano Augusto [EMAIL PROTECTED] wrote:

 Se você  a cada imagem atribuir-lhe  uma versão diferente, dá  para conviver
 sem problemas. É  só ajustar os gerenciador de boot  (lilo) para enxergar os
 componentes da nova imagem (vmlinuz e initrd) que ficam em '/boot'.

Só é necessário renomear o núcleo velho antes de instalar o novo e fazer uma 
entrada para o antigo no lilo?

-- 
Savio Martins Ramos Arquiteto
Rio de Janeiro  ICQ 174972645
Pirataria não!  Use GNU/Linux
Debian-br #705 Unstable
http://www.debian.org



Re: Como instalar duas imagens do Kernel

2004-04-06 Por tôpico Douglas Adriano Augusto
No dia 06/04/2004 às 20:47,
Savio Ramos [EMAIL PROTECTED] escreveu:

 On Tue, 6 Apr 2004 15:30:46 -0300
 Douglas Adriano Augusto [EMAIL PROTECTED] wrote:
 
  Se você  a cada imagem atribuir-lhe  uma versão diferente, dá  para conviver
  sem problemas. É  só ajustar os gerenciador de boot  (lilo) para enxergar os
  componentes da nova imagem (vmlinuz e initrd) que ficam em '/boot'.
 
 Só é necessário renomear o núcleo velho antes de instalar o novo e fazer uma 
 entrada para o antigo no lilo?

O recomendado  é você atribuir  ao quérnel  gerado uma versão  diferente das
instaladas no sistema, o que difere de renomear. Acho que o caminho é passar
ao make-kpkg o argumento --append_to_version, como o Alexandre falou.


-- 
Douglas Augusto
  [Netiqueta]
§ Evitar e-mails HTML, mesmo oferecendo alternativa puramente textual.